PC SOFT

PROFESSIONAL NEWSGROUPS
WINDEVWEBDEV and WINDEV Mobile

Home → WINDEV (earlier versions) → Traitement des champs de type durée avec SQL Server
Traitement des champs de type durée avec SQL Server
Started by K. MAHFOUDI, Mar., 09 2004 2:56 PM - 1 reply
Posted on March, 09 2004 - 2:56 PM
Salut tout le monde.
Mon probléme et le suivant:
J'utilise Windev 75 avec SQL Server 7 pour le développement d'une aplication
de GMAO. Je dois effectuer de traitements sur des durées.
Avec Windev 75, on a le typé durée, mais ce n'est pas le cas avec SQL Server.

Un champ de type réel ne me régle pas le probléme, car 1,50 veut dire 1heure
50 minute, alors que mathématiquement, ça veut dire un et demi.
Si quelqu'un a eu à traiter ce probléme, qu'il m'éclaire.
Posted on March, 09 2004 - 6:03 PM
Salut,

Essaye de réduire tes durées à la plus petite unité, comme lorsque tu
utilisé la fonction heureversentier :
1 minute = 60 secondes = 6000 ms, ...
ensuite pour faire tes calculs tu n'as plus qu'a faire tes opération sur
cette unité là et à retransformer en chaine par la fonction entierversheure

Bon courage

Fred.

"K. MAHFOUDI" <kmahfoudi@yahoo.fr> a écrit dans le message de
news:404dc1f6$1@news.pcsoft.fr...


Salut tout le monde.
Mon probléme et le suivant:
J'utilise Windev 75 avec SQL Server 7 pour le développement d'une

aplication
de GMAO. Je dois effectuer de traitements sur des durées.
Avec Windev 75, on a le typé durée, mais ce n'est pas le cas avec SQL

Server.

Un champ de type réel ne me régle pas le probléme, car 1,50 veut dire

1heure
50 minute, alors que mathématiquement, ça veut dire un et demi.
Si quelqu'un a eu à traiter ce probléme, qu'il m'éclaire.